springboot实践
时间: 2023-10-12 13:06:40 浏览: 103
Spring Boot是一个用于开发微服务的Java框架,它提供了许多最佳实践来简化Spring应用程序的开发流程。以下是一些常见的Spring Boot实践:
1. 使用Spring Initializr:Spring Initializr是一个用于快速生成Spring Boot项目的工具。通过Initializr,你可以选择所需的依赖项和项目配置,并生成一个基本的项目结构。这使得启动新的Spring Boot项目变得非常简单和高效。
2. 遵循自动配置原则:Spring Boot提供了自动配置功能,它根据项目的依赖项和配置自动配置Spring应用程序。这意味着你不需要手动配置大量的XML文件或Java代码,而是可以依靠Spring Boot自动完成。这样,你可以节省大量的时间和精力,并且更专注于业务逻辑的开发。
3. 使用Spring Boot Starter依赖项:Spring Boot提供了一系列的Starter依赖项,它们包含了常见的库和框架,并提供了预配置的依赖项和默认设置。通过使用这些Starter依赖项,你可以轻松地集成第三方库和框架,并快速搭建功能强大的应用程序。
4. 使用注解驱动开发:Spring Boot鼓励使用注解驱动的开发方式。通过使用注解,你可以简化配置和显式的依赖注入,并且提高代码的可读性和可维护性。一些常用的注解包括@Controller、@Service、@Repository等。
通过采用这些Spring Boot实践,你可以更高效地开发基于Spring的微服务,并且在长期运行中也能够取得更好的成功。祝你好运!<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[SpringBoot 实战 开发中 16 条最佳实践](https://blog.csdn.net/agonie201218/article/details/130609339)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]
阅读全文